J Wrigley Vineyards
John and Jody Wrigley moved to Oregon from Idaho and Arizona, respectively. A wine tasting trip to Oregon grabbed their interest and was followed by many more visits to Oregon looking for property. In 2006, they bought 200 acres in the McMinnville AVA of Yamhill Valley and in 2008 planted nearly 10 acres of Pinot Noir, Riesling and Chardonnay. The first vintage of J Wrigley MAC Cuvee was 2009 sourced from Yamhill Valley Vineyards and Coleman Vineyards. The first estate wines are projected for the 2011 vintage. Planned production eventually is 2,000 cases of estate wines. John is the winemaker. A tasting room in Carlton is shared with Noble Pig Winery. The wines are available through the website as well. |
